Washington DC
I had the good fortune after Valentines weekend to take a trip to DC with the general purpose of eating at KOMI, which I wholeheartedly recommend. A couple of dishes really stood out the scallops with marcona almonds, the Pork Belly Hoagie and the frozen Baklava. They also had an outstanding 1999 white Rioja from Lopez de Heredia and an Espresso Stout from Hitachino. Also while in DC I got to catch up with some old friends at Oyamel I had a very spread out lunch with Amanda an old friend who is now pastry chef at KOMI. We had an awesome gin and tonic and grasshopper taco both pictured above and some fun coffee creations from our server. For dinner that night I had a wonderfully prepared cassoulet made by my good friend Paul who is a patent attorney/sous chef in training. I was also able to catch up with Levi Meczick the new chef at The Jockey Club for a very quick lunch. I expect to hear some great things coming out of there very soon.
